A versatile, MVVM-compatible replacement for WPFs WebBrowser control, with full support for data binding and responsive UI behaviour.
     Also includes an MVVM-compatible MarkdownBrowser control, powered by Strapdown.js!

     Previous version changes:
     WpfBrowser:
       WpfBrowser now uses a single Target property for navigating etc. Uses Uri scheme (http[s]://, file:// and content:// are supported out-of-the-box) to determine navigation etc.
     MarkdownBrowser:
       Now includes an additional RootPath property which, when set, will cause all links to other .md documents to be rewritten, prefixing them with the given path. This will usually be a relative path (relative to the app's location).
